    """This class implements the Medusa draft model from the paper: https://arxiv.org/abs/2401.10774
    Reference implementation: https://github.com/FasterDecoding/Medusa
    
    Differences from reference implementation:
    1. Currently this only supports generating proposals from top-1 tokens.
    2. We have an optional token_map which reduces draft vocab to most 
       frequently used tokens to give some additional speed-up by reducing 
       sampling overhead. This is disabled unless the checkpoint file has 
       explicit token_map tensor and config has an optional attribute 
       truncated_vocab_size < vocab_size. To use this technique, one has to find
       the top-k most frequent tokens in target dataset and add that as a tensor
       in the draft checkpoint (using key token_map). Also, the draft config
       needs to have truncated_vocab_size (=k) as an attribute."""

    def medusa_sample(
        self,
        medusa_logits: List[torch.Tensor],
        sampling_metadata: SamplingMetadata,
        logits: torch.Tensor,
        medusa_buffers: Dict[str, Any]
    ) -> List[SamplerOutput]:
        batch_size = logits.shape[0]
        candidates_logit = torch.argmax(logits, dim=-1).view(batch_size, -1) # [batch_size, 1]
        
        medusa_logits = torch.stack(medusa_logits, dim=0) # [medusa_heads, batch_size, vocab_size]

        # Extract the TOPK candidates from the medusa logits.
        candidates_medusa_logits = torch.topk(medusa_logits, TOPK, dim=-1).indices # [medusa_heads, batch_size, TOPK]
        candidates_medusa_logits = candidates_medusa_logits.permute(1, 0 ,2) # [batch_size, medusa_heads, TOPK]
        candidates_medusa_logits = candidates_medusa_logits.reshape(batch_size, -1)

        # Combine the selected candidate from the original logits with the topk medusa logits.
        candidates = torch.cat([candidates_logit, candidates_medusa_logits], dim=-1)  #[batch_size, 1+medusa_heads*TOPK] 

        # Map the combined candidates to the tree indices to get tree candidates.
        tree_candidates = torch.index_select(candidates, dim=-1, index=medusa_buffers['tree_indices']) # [batch_size, choices]

        # Extend the tree candidates by appending a zero.
        tree_candidates_ext = torch.cat([tree_candidates, torch.zeros((batch_size, 1),
                                                    dtype=torch.long, device=tree_candidates.device)], dim=-1) # [batch_size, choices]

        # Retrieve the cartesian candidates using the retrieve indices.
        cart_candidates = tree_candidates_ext[:, medusa_buffers['retrieve_indices']] # [batch_size, retrieve_size, max_depth]

        token_id_list = []
        cart_candidate_list = []

        for idx, seq_group in enumerate(sampling_metadata.seq_groups):
            token_id_list.append(tree_candidates[seq_group.sample_indices, :])
            cart_candidate_list.append(cart_candidates[seq_group.sample_indices, :])

        outputs: List[Optional[SamplerOutput]] = []
        for idx in range(len(sampling_metadata.seq_groups)):
            outputs.append(
                SamplerOutput(
                    outputs=None,
                    sampled_token_ids=token_id_list[idx].squeeze(1),
                    cart_candidates=cart_candidate_list[idx]
                ))

        return outputs
